The City of Plymouth outdoor Farmers Market is open 2:30-6:30 p.m. each Wednesday through Oct. 6 at Parkers Lake Playfield, 15500 County Road 6.

Sparkling Cucumber Basil Lemonade
Ingredients:
- 3-inch length of cucumber, chilled and coarsely chopped (about 1/2 cup), plus some extra slices for garnish
- 2 to 3 fresh basil leaves, plus more for garnish
- 1/4 cup fresh lemon juice, plus lemon slices for garnish
- 1/4 cup still water
- 3/4 cup sparking water
- 1 tablespoon honey or agave nectar
Instructions:
- Add the chopped cucumber to a blender or food processor with the basil, lemon juice, still water and honey. Blend until smooth, then distribute evenly between two glasses.
- Add the sparkling water, again splitting evenly between the glasses. Drop in a few ice cubes, and garnish with cucumber slices, lemon slices and basil, as desired.

Reminders while at the market: Dogs are not allowed, with the exception of service dogs. The market begins promptly at 2:30 p.m. and no early purchases are allowed. Some vendors offer credit card payments, but please bring cash for those who do not.
Personal Shopper Program
The Personal Shopper Program returns and is available for those who wish to remain in their vehicle while visiting the market. Market staff will complete shopping lists and deliver items to customers waiting in their vehicles 3:30-5:30 p.m. on market days.
Please park at the designated parking spots across from the market entrance and call 763-290-9821 for a personal shopper. This number will only be answered during market hours.
